Renovating typically involves restoring a space to a good condition, often with cosmetic updates. Remodeling goes further, fundamentally changing a space's layout, function, or structure. Both enhance a home, but remodeling involves more significant alterations.
The adequacy of $50,000 for a house renovation depends heavily on the scope and location. Major structural changes or high-end finishes can quickly exceed this budget. For smaller projects or specific room updates in Kansas, it might be sufficient.
